“It is raining”. , one cannot have variables that stand for books or tables. But That means today's subject matter is first-order logic, which is extending propositional logic so that we can talk about things. First-order logic, like all other systems of formal logic, is a method for formalizing natural languages into a computable format. This, in turn, allows us to treat problems expressed through linguistic sentences in a formal manner. First-order logic allows us to build complex expressions out of the basic ones. Starting with the variables and constants, we can use the function symbols to build up compound expressions like these: Such expressions are called “terms.” Intuitively, they name objects in the intended domain of discourse.

First-order logic (FOL) • More expressive than propositional logic • Eliminates deficiencies of PL by: – Representing objects, their properties, relations and statements about them; – Introducing variables that refer to an arbitrary objects and can be substituted by a specific object – Introducing quantifiers allowing us to make First-order logic is also called Predicate logic and First-order predicate calculus (FOPL). It is a formal representation of logic in the form of quantifiers. In predicate logic, the input is taken as an entity, and the output it gives is either true or false. Syntax and Semantics of FOPL First-order logical consequence can be established using deductive systems for rst-order logic. In particular, extensions of the Propositional Semantic Tableau and Natural Deduction, with additional rules for the quanti ers, can be constructed that are sound and complete for rst-order logic.

– Propositional logic 14 Oct 1998 First-Order Logic (FOL or FOPC) Syntax · A term (denoting a real-world individual ) is a constant symbol, a variable symbol, or an n-place function 2018年1月9日 First-order logic assumes that the world consists of objects with certain relations among them that do or do not hold. The formal models are First-order logic (FOL) is a language in symbolic science, which is used by mathematicians, philosophers, linguists, and computer scientists.

Journal of Logic and Computation, 15(5):701–749, 2005. [ finite state automata and regular expressions • context-free grammars and languages • Turing Machines • first-order logic • propositional and predicate logic “On the idea of a general proof theory”, Synthese 27, pp 63-77. - reprinted in: A Philosophicul Compunion to First-Order Logic, pp 212-.

2 15 Aug 2018 A 0-ary function symbol is also called a constant symbol. Joris Roos.

First-order logic is a formal logical system used in mathematics, philosophy, linguistics, and computer science. Kinetics, First-Order Logic, Reaction Rate, Reaction Mechanism Nonnull asymptotic distributions of the LR, Wald, score and gradient statistics in generalized linear models with dispersion covariates The class of generalized linear models with dispersion covariates, which allows us to jointly model the mean and dispersion parameters, is a natural extension to the classical generalized linear
We make complex sentences with connectives (just like in proposition logic). binary relation function property objects connectives.

Knowledge-based agents use logic to represent the world Deduce the actions to take; The logic language Propositional logic can´t represent complex environments in concise way; Require first-order-logic; First-order-logic or First-order predicate-calculus. Sufficiently expressive; Foundation of other representation languages semantics of first-order logic (1.4 hours to learn) Summary. The semantics of a first-order language is defined in terms of mathematical structures which give the meanings of all the constants, functions, and predicates in the language.